JUst pulled up the box score on the Yahoo! Cubs update thingie...

 

Are the Cubs bats that good, or is PIttsburgh's pitching that bad?

 

I don't think the Pirates pitching is "that bad", if that tells you anything. When you can beat, Snell, Gorzalanny (sp?), and Duke, that's a damn fine good weekend of work.

 

The fact that the Cubs are on the verge of sweeping the Pirates without Zambrano seeing the hill in this series is quite the accomplishment.

 

The offense has been really good so far. The pitching has been so-so. I'm hoping the pitching starts to turn it around (particularly Lilly, Hill, Howry, and Wuertz in that order), especially considering we're going to need it going into September.
